    Stationary bicycle – what parameters you should pay attention to

    If it’s your first bike, then surely when browsing the offers on the Internet you already have a head full of various descriptions, features, and other things. However, what is most important, when choosing the right stationary bike? Here are some parameters you need to pay attention to. 

    • the maximum load of the device – choose a stationary bike that will fit your weight. Therefore, before buying, pay attention to how many kilograms the device can bear. 
    • saddle and handlebar adjustment – to exercise comfortably and for you to improve your figure, you need to adjust the height of the saddle and the distance of the handlebars. This will help you adjust it to your height. 
    • dimensions and weight of the stationary bike – pay attention to whether the model will fit in your room. This will be especially important if you want to purchase a stationary bike for a smaller room. 
    • the weight of the flywheel – the heavier it is, the more resistance it can produce. This affects the quality and efficiency of your workouts. At the very beginning, 13-17 lbs is enough. 
    • stable construction – it is best to see the model in person beforehand. Take a close look at the design. 
    • several training programs – decide whether you need as many as 20 training programs. Maybe only 5 will be enough? Remember that the more training is available, the higher the price of the device. Is it worth it? You’ll have to decide for yourself. 
    • features to help you during your workout – see if the device has basic functions that will make your workout more enjoyable, e.g. measuring distance and exercise time, and connection to a smartphone.
    • manufacturer and store – beforehand, read user reviews of the company and equipment in question. This will help you make a good decision. Often such comments are very helpful. You will see more advantages and disadvantages of the bike, which you will not learn about from the store or manufacturer’s website.

    Mechanical, magnetic and electromagnetic stationary bicycles – what are the basic differences?

    The main difference is the usage of the resistance mechanism. It means the method of braking the wheel. 

    • Mechanical bicycle – the simplest design. The resistance mechanism works on the principle of friction of the flywheel. 
    • Magnetic bicycle – a precise resistance mechanism that works through a magnetic brake. 
    • Electromagnetic bicycle – the resistance mechanism works through a microprocessor. It regulates the operation of the electric motor.

    Construction of a stationary mechanical bicycle 

    If you are just starting your adventure with stationary bicycles, the mechanical one can be an excellent option. They have a simple design and are the cheapest bikes available on the market. Therefore, even if after a few weeks you find that it’s not for you, the loss will not be as great as if you bought another type. 

    The main thing to focus on in this model is the resistance mechanism, the brake. It is adjustable through a roller or belt. Its adjustment is done by changing the tension of the belt. 

    The operation is not complicated. It doesn’t have a lot of electronics, so you won’t have much trouble exercising. 

    For whom is the stationary mechanical bicycle?

    It’s an excellent choice for beginners who won’t exercise on it too often. It is also a good option for those who intend to use the device only for recreational purposes. Thanks to its simple design and operation, it will be suitable for older people.

    Stationary mechanical bicycle – pros and cons 

    Pros 

    • simple design – with a knob, you can adjust the height of the saddle and handlebars. Free and easy adjustment to the user. 
    • low failure rate – it does not have complex technology, so you will not have to worry that any function will break down right away or you will not start the device.
    • simple operation – you will perform the workout without much trouble, even if you are not an expert when it comes to stationary bikes. 
    • low price – you won’t spend a huge amount of dollars on the equipment. You can spend the rest on other pleasures or important things. 
    • does not need power – it works without being connected to a power source. 

    Cons 

    • noisy operation – if you want peace, not with this device. The friction of the flywheel produces a loud noise that can disturb you. It’s best not to exercise at night then, so as not to disturb your family or neighbors. Put on headphones or turn on the TV louder to drown out the noise.
    • little load adjustment – you won’t do intense workouts on this machine. 
    • no additional options – functions are limited by the device’s scant electronics. Yes, you will do a basic workout but don’t count on much. 
    • no workout plans – there is only a calorie, pace, and distance counter. That’s all you get at this price.

    Construction of a stationary magnetic bicycle 

    As you can guess the operation, as well as the construction of this device, is already more complicated than a mechanical bicycle. All because there is already more technology and electronics in such models.

    What’s more, these bicycles include a magnetic brake. It creates a magnetic field through magnets surrounding the flywheel, which allows you to adjust precise settings and choose the right level of resistance.

    For whom is the stationary mechanical bicycle?

    This stationary bike should be chosen by people who want to exercise intensely and precisely. Thanks to the weight of the flywheel and the magnetic brake, the exercises you perform on the bike might be more effective. A decent workout on this machine is assured.

    Stationary magnetic bicycle – pros and cons 

    Pros

    • quiet operation of the device – thanks to its resistance mechanism, it does not produce loud noises, so you can freely train at any time. Family members and neighbors will surely appreciate this equipment. You will be able to relax in silence while training.
    • resistance mechanism – thanks to it you can adjust the resistance of your workout and adapt it to your abilities and condition. 
    • workout programs – thanks to the electronics on the device, there are workout programs that will help you increase the effectiveness of your workouts and achieve the shape and figure of your dreams. 
    • console control – precisely set your workout. Control by console, not a knob like a mechanical bike.

    Cons 

    • higher price – this bike is more expensive than a mechanical bike, so you have to expect to spend more. You pay for the extra features and technology. 
    • complicated repair – more electronics can cause the bike to break down more often. This involves repairs, sometimes expensive ones. 
    • weight of the device – because of the heavy flywheel, it will be difficult for you to move the magnetic bike from one place to another. 
    • need a power source – choose a place where there is a socket close by.

    Construction of a stationary magnetic bicycle 

    Electromagnetic bicycles are all about high and sophisticated technology and electronics. It makes the whole workout enjoyable and accurately adapted to your skills. You don’t have to worry about anything. 

    The resistance mechanism works through a microprocessor. It is what makes the measurements and all workouts so precise. What’s more, it can produce even a very high resistance during the ride.

    For whom is the stationary electromagnetic bicycle?

    This equipment is designed for people who want to train intensively. Moreover, for advanced athletes who have experience. Regular and frequent riding on this equipment will be a great pleasure for everyone.

    Stationary electromagnetic bicycle – pros and cons 

    Pros 

    • very quiet – want to exercise without any noise? Enjoy the peace? If so, bet on an electromagnetic bike. 
    • additional equipment – you can add equipment to your bike to make your workout easier. You can bet on a bottle or phone holder. 
    • a lot of additional features – a lot of electronics means more possibilities. For example, you can test your heart rate, connect your phone to the bike with a special app and keep track of your workout and analyze your results. 
    • high resistance setting – you will be able to exercise more intensively.

    Cons

    • high price – lots of amenities and electronics = more dollars to spend. Consider whether you need such equipment for your home. Because of the expensive equipment, many people go to the gym to use it. 
    • difficult to repair – the fact that there are a lot of electronics there is a greater risk that something may break. Moreover, it can sometimes be difficult to find the cause of the malfunction.

    What else is worth knowing about? – Brake mechanisms in a mechanical bicycle

    Band brake mechanism – is the cheapest and is suitable for slower driving. If you accelerate too much, the belt may wear out. Therefore, if you are planning long but leisurely workouts, this choice will be suitable for you. 

    Brake pad mechanism – if you care about more intense workouts, then choose this type of mechanism. They are most often used in spinning bikes (you will see them in gyms).

    Stationary bike – recumbent vs upright

    You’ve already learned about the different types of stationary bikes, but that’s not all. On the market, you will still find recumbent and upright equipment. How do they differ from each other? How are they built? What advantages do they have? For whom will they be an ideal choice? Let’s check it out together!

    Upright stationary bike – construction

    This is a tall bike that has no backrest. It also has a high saddle, which is adjustable and you can adjust it to your height. It does not have a backrest because when you exercise, your torso is bent forward, so a backrest is not needed. 

    Because the stationary bike has a high saddle, your legs are straight and stay upright. Such a bike can imitate riding a real bicycle. It is small, so you can put it even in a small room and exercise.

    For whom is the upright stationary bike?

    It is ideal for anyone who loves to ride a bicycle. With such equipment, even on rainy or hot days, you can exercise. 

    What’s more, this type of stationary bike will work well for people who struggle with cardiovascular diseases and cardiovascular problems.

    Positive effects of riding an upright stationary bike 

    • improved fitness, 
    • strengthening calf and thigh muscles, 
    • burning unnecessary calories, 
    • better lung capacity, 
    • improved cardiovascular and lung function.

    Recumbent stationary bike – construction

    This bike differs in its design from the previous one. The pedals are extended far forward. Therefore, the design is more horizontal rather than vertical. 

    The design is also a low saddle, which has a high backrest. It allows you to exercise freely and comfortably. The saddle has special handles that help you stay on the saddle so you don’t shift. 

    It takes up more space than an upright stationary bike. Therefore, before buying, see what dimensions the equipment has and whether it will fit in your room without much problem.

    For whom is the recumbent stationary bike?

    Thanks to the fact that it has a saddle with a backrest because it will be perfect for people who have back problems. This allows them to sit comfortably and exercise without worrying about straining their back. 

    Recumbent stationary bikes can also be used by people who are severely obese. It will be comfortable, they will not strain their joints, and they will freely exercise and burn off excess weight. It will also work well for the elderly, and people who want to return to an active lifestyle after an injury.

    Positive effects of riding a recumbent stationary bike 

    • takes care of the lumbar spine, 
    • increases endurance, 
    • provides growth of thigh and calf muscles, 
    • improves fitness, 
    • burns unnecessary calories.
